This article examines the reasons that women and men give in explaining why women willingly agree to sexual intimacy when they would rather not be intimate at that time. Data collected from a sample of students on a southern campus included a set of scales which measured the beliefs about why women consent to unwanted sexual intercourse held by men and women. The findings indicated that most sexual intercourse was consensual and mutually desired. Perceived reasons for consent to unwanted sex by women varied for men and women, as did the ranking of relative importance of the reasons. Some support was found for the contention that compliance might be a function of gender socialization. 相似文献

Habitual offender acts have been adopted by 43 states and are under consideration in the legislatures of others. These acts
have been adopted with relatively little evaluation of the costs involved in the implementation of this legislation. This
study seeks to evaluate the extent to which Alabama’s habitual offender statute captures serious career criminals. The results
indicate that the differences between those in the prison population sentenced under habitual offender statutes and those
sentenced under other statutes is not significant. There does appear to be support for the contention that the majority of
prisoners have substantial criminal histories; however, it is noted that many have not committed a severe crime.
The exaggerated claims for the number of crimes committed by “typical” offenders and resultant high costs of non-incarceration
are examined and challenged. The authors suggest that the resources available to deal with offenders could be better invested
in the development and testing of community-based programs designed to divert offenders from a life of crime rather than in
programs which intervene after criminal histories are severe and which invoke life-long incarceration as a remedy.

Judges are under pressure both to combat crime with longer prison sentences and to increase the use of sentencing options which permit use of a graduated system of dispositions which can be used to rehabilitate offenders. The judges are faced with overcrowded prisons and a general lack of the community programs recommended by many professional organizations and scholars. It is recommended here that judges take an active role in encouraging the development of community-based alternatives such as local work release. This study found that a male judge is a more effective communicator than a bailiff and that he could cause a change in attitude toward work release in a sample of citizens. Thus, judges can anticipate some degree of success if they choose to participate in efforts to develop community support for sentencing alternatives. 相似文献
